The GCC version 2.95.3-5 come with cygwin version 1.3.10 as a package can compile C source file with DOS end-of-line character. However, the GCC built by myself can not compile DOS C file correctly. Here is the C source file: 1 #define ABC 1,\ 2 2,\ 3 3 4 5 void main() 6 { 7 } If this C program is saved as a DOS text file, my GCC will complain about line 2. If this C program is saved as a UNIX text file, compile is OK. It seems like my GCC compiler can not detect DOS end-of-line (CR/LF). Is there any flag to set while building the GCC or any GCC options can handle the DOS text file format?
